Description and Requirements

Have You heard? Lenovo is looking for a Sport IT Architect Lead!

Are You passionate about sports, technology and innovation? Check out this role!

You will report to the Director of SSG Technical Solution Architect - Sports Vertical.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Take ownership of solution architecture post-sales, ensuring alignment with Lenovo standards and best practices across delivery teams.
  • Design and maintain end-to-end architectures, consolidating systems, defining requirements (scalability, security, resilience), and ensuring compliance throughout project lifecycle.
  • Translate business and technical requirements into implementable solutions, partnering closely with engineering teams and overseeing NFRs, SLAs, and testing.
  • Drive innovation by collaborating with product managers, business units, R&D, and partners to develop reusable architecture patterns and optimize delivery.
  • Monitor and optimize infrastructure costs, identifying efficiencies and cross-project synergies to reduce complexity and improve time-to-delivery.
  • Support pre-sales and project scoping by contributing to SOWs with clear technical assumptions, constraints, and requirements.
  • Lead technical strategy for POCs and incubation initiatives, evaluating outcomes and defining requirements for scalable, secure productization.
  • Provide operational architecture support for major events, ensuring readiness through audits, governance policies, and risk mitigation measures.

Required Experience:

  •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related technical discipline (or equivalent practical experience).
  • 5+ years in solution, enterprise, or technical architecture roles, including end-to-end ownership of complex, multi-system implementations; experience in sports technology or comparable high-availability, event-driven environments is strongly preferred.
  • Demonstrated success designing architectures for large, integration-heavy programs (applications, data, networks, and infrastructure), ideally supporting major sports events or similar mission-critical operations.
  • Strong hands-on knowledge of hybrid cloud and modern application architecture, including APIs, microservices, data integration patterns, and AI/ML-enabled solutions.
  • Proficiency with architecture diagramming tools (e.g., Lucidchart, Draw.io) and presentation software; able to communicate designs clearly to technical and non-technical audiences.
  • Deep technical knowledge to earn the respect of client IT/engineering teams and internal product/engineering groups.
  • The unique ability to translate complex technical concepts into clear business value for non-technical stakeholders
  • Sees the "big picture" and can architect solutions that are scalable, secure, and aligned with the client's long-term strategy.
